Commit 4bc1bbb2 authored by David Mendez's avatar David Mendez
Browse files

add functional test for facets group config

parent 93a12e88
......@@ -6,7 +6,7 @@
import argparse
from specific_tests import fun_test_simple_query, fun_test_query_with_context, fun_test_property_config, \
fun_test_group_config
fun_test_group_config, fun_test_facets_group_config
PARSER = argparse.ArgumentParser()
PARSER.add_argument('server_base_path', help='server base path to run the tests against',
......@@ -23,7 +23,7 @@ def run():
print(f'Running functional tests on {ARGS.server_base_path}')
for test_module in [fun_test_simple_query, fun_test_query_with_context, fun_test_property_config,
fun_test_group_config]:
fun_test_group_config, fun_test_facets_group_config]:
test_module.run_test(ARGS.server_base_path, ARGS.delayed_jobs_server_base_path)
......
# pylint: disable=import-error,unused-argument
"""
Module that tests a facets group config
"""
import requests
from specific_tests import utils
def run_test(server_base_url, delayed_jobs_server_base_path):
"""
Tests getting the configuration of a facets group
:param server_base_url: base url of the running server. E.g. http://127.0.0.1:5000
:param delayed_jobs_server_base_path: base path for the delayed_jobs
"""
print('-------------------------------------------')
print('Testing getting the configuration of a facets group')
print('-------------------------------------------')
url = f'{server_base_url}/properties_configuration/facets/chembl_activity/browser_facets'
print('url: ', url)
config_request = requests.get(url)
status_code = config_request.status_code
print(f'status_code: {status_code}')
response_text = config_request.text
utils.print_es_response(response_text)
assert status_code == 200, 'The request failed!'
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ment